Pakistan, April 26 -- The US Commission on International Religious Freedom (USCIRF) has asked India to stop punishing Kashmiri Muslims after the Pahalgam attack. The Commission condemned the violence but warned against revenge actions targeting a specific community. It reminded India to protect all religious groups equally.
USCIRF Commissioner Vicky Hartzler urged India to uphold religious freedom. She said people must be free to follow their faith without fear. She also stressed that no one should face harm or threats based on religion or region.
